Can Box Turtles Eat Spinach?

As someone who values the nutrition of spinach, you might wonder about its suitability for your box turtle. Spinach, a leafy green vegetable, is often praised for its health benefits in human diets, but does it offer the same advantages to box turtles? This article investigates “Can box turtles eat spinach?”, exploring the nutritional profile of spinach and how it can fit into a box turtle’s diet. While spinach is rich in vitamins and minerals, it’s essential to consider its effects on turtles, including potential risks and the right way to include it in their diet.

Can Box Turtles Eat Spinach?

Spinach is a nutritious vegetable that can be beneficial for box turtles when included in their diet. It is rich in vitamins A, C, and K, as well as minerals like iron and calcium. However, spinach also contains oxalates, which can bind to calcium and other minerals, making them less available to the turtle’s body.


  • High in essential vitamins and minerals.
  • Supports overall health and wellbeing.


  • Oxalates in spinach can interfere with nutrient absorption.
  • Should be fed in moderation to avoid health issues.

Given these factors, spinach should be a part of a balanced and varied diet for box turtles. It can provide essential nutrients but should not be the sole vegetable offered.

How to Feed Spinach to Turtles?

Feeding spinach to box turtles involves some considerations for their health and safety. First, ensure that the spinach is thoroughly washed to remove any pesticides or chemicals. It’s also beneficial to chop the spinach into small, manageable pieces to make it easier for the turtle to consume.

Feeding Guidelines:

  • Mix spinach with other vegetables to provide a balanced diet.
  • Offer spinach in small amounts, not exceeding 10-15% of the turtle’s total vegetable intake.
  • Vary the greens in the turtle’s diet to avoid over-reliance on spinach.
Spinach Nutrition Facts

Spinach offers a range of nutrients that can be beneficial for box turtles. Key nutritional components include:

  • Vitamin A: Supports vision and immune health.
  • Vitamin C: Important for immune function.
  • Vitamin K: Essential for blood clotting and bone health.
  • Iron: Supports blood health.
  • Calcium: Vital for shell and bone strength.

However, the presence of oxalates in spinach can inhibit calcium absorption, which is a consideration for turtles’ diets. Moderation is key to ensure that the benefits of these nutrients are realized without the risks associated with high oxalate consumption.

Do Box Turtles Like Spinach?

Box turtles may show varying preferences for spinach. Some turtles enjoy leafy greens like spinach, while others might be less inclined to eat them. Introducing spinach into their diet should be done gradually, observing how the turtle reacts to this new food.

Tips for Introducing Spinach:

  • Start with small amounts mixed with other familiar foods.
  • Monitor the turtle’s acceptance and any changes in health.

Health Risks For Box Turtles Eating Spinach

While spinach can be a healthy part of a box turtle’s diet, there are potential risks associated with feeding it. The primary concern is the oxalate content, which can bind to calcium and other minerals, reducing their availability for absorption.

Potential Risks:

  • Reduced calcium absorption leading to shell and bone problems.
  • Nutritional imbalances if spinach is overfed.

To mitigate these risks, spinach should be fed in moderation and as part of a diverse diet. Regularly offering a variety of greens and vegetables can help ensure the turtle receives a balanced intake of nutrients.

How Much Spinach Should Box Turtles Eat

How Much Spinach Should Box Turtles Eat?

The amount of spinach that is appropriate for a box turtle varies depending on the individual turtle’s size, age, and overall health. As a general guideline, spinach should not make up more than 10-15% of the turtle’s total vegetable intake.


  • A small portion of spinach can be offered once or twice a week.
  • Mix spinach with other vegetables to ensure dietary variety.
  • Adjust portions based on the turtle’s response and nutritional needs.

How Do You Prepare a Spinach Recipe For Turtles?

A spinach-based recipe for box turtles can provide them with a nutritious and enjoyable meal. A basic recipe might include chopped spinach mixed with other vegetables and a calcium supplement.

Simple Spinach Mix:

  1. Chop spinach into small pieces.
  2. Combine with other vegetables like carrots or squash.
  3. Add a calcium supplement for nutritional balance.

This mix offers the nutritional benefits of spinach along with a variety of other vegetables, ensuring a balanced meal for your turtle.

Can Baby and Senior Box Turtles Eat Spinach?

Both baby and senior box turtles can eat spinach, but it should be offered in accordance with their specific dietary needs. Baby turtles, which require a diet higher in protein and calcium, should have spinach as only a small part of their diet. For senior turtles, ensure that the spinach is chopped finely to aid in easy consumption.

Feeding Tips:

  • Baby turtles: Focus on protein-rich foods, using spinach sparingly.
  • Senior turtles: Offer finely chopped spinach for easier digestion.

Professional Advice

Consulting with a veterinarian or reptile nutritionist is advisable when introducing spinach to a box turtle’s diet. They can provide tailored advice based on the turtle’s specific health needs and dietary requirements. Reliable information can also be found through associations like the Association of Reptilian and Amphibian Veterinarians (ARAV).


In conclusion, spinach can be a beneficial addition to a box turtle’s diet when included in moderation. Its rich nutrient content supports overall health, but care must be taken to balance it with other foods due to its oxalate content. Each turtle is unique, and their diet should be tailored to their specific needs. Introduce spinach gradually and always prioritize a diverse and balanced diet for your turtle’s health and well-being. For personalized dietary plans, consult a reptile nutrition expert or veterinarian.

Can box turtles eat spinach every day?

No, spinach should not be fed daily due to its oxalate content. It’s best to include it occasionally in a varied diet.

Are there any turtles that should not eat spinach?

Turtles with specific health issues, especially related to calcium absorption, might need to have spinach limited in their diet.

Can I feed my box turtle frozen spinach?

Yes, but ensure it’s thawed and free of additives. Fresh spinach is preferable.

Is raw or cooked spinach better for box turtles?

Raw spinach is generally better as cooking can reduce nutrient content.

How do I know if my turtle likes spinach?

Observe your turtle’s eating habits. If they readily eat spinach and show no health issues, it’s likely they enjoy it.

What other greens can I feed my turtle besides spinach?

Other suitable greens include kale, dandelion greens, and romaine lettuce.

Are there any special preparations needed for feeding spinach to turtles?

Wash thoroughly, chop into small pieces, and mix with other foods for a balanced diet.

